Title:
ELECTRODE CATALYST LAYER, MEMBRANE ELECTRODE ASSEMBLY, AND SOLID POLYMER FUEL CELL
Document Type and Number:
WIPO Patent Application WO/2022/124407
Kind Code:
A1
Abstract:
The purpose of the present invention is to provide an electrode catalyst layer, a membrane electrode assembly, and a solid polymer fuel cell, which are capable of improving material transport properties and proton conductivity in the electrode catalyst layer, and which are capable of exhibiting high power generation performance over the long term and have good durability. An electrode catalyst layer (10) is an electrode catalyst layer used in a solid polymer fuel cell, and includes: a catalyst material (12); a conductive carrier (13) that supports the catalyst material (12); a polymer electrolyte (14); and a fibrous material (15), wherein the fibrous material (15) contains a substance having a nitrogen atom, and is included in an amount of 1-12 wt% (exclusive of 12) in the electrode catalyst layer (10).
